Character AI

Platform for creating and chatting with AI characters for entertainment and learning

Character AI is a AI-powered service that provides platform for creating and chatting with ai characters for entertainment and learning. Founded in 2021 and headquartered in Palo Alto, California, Character AI offers 2 pricing plans. It offers a free tier as well as paid plans starting from $9.99/month. Key features include AI characters, Voice chat, Character creation, Group chats. Character AI is a popular choice for users looking for quality ai subscriptions.

The Wall Street Journal

Business and financial news subscription

The Wall Street Journal is a news and media service that provides business and financial news subscription. Founded in 1889 and headquartered in New York, New York, The Wall Street Journal offers 2 pricing plans. Plans start from $4/month. Key features include Business news, Markets data, Opinion, Podcasts. The Wall Street Journal is a popular choice for users looking for quality news subscriptions.
